Abstract
We present a new semiclassical method, based on an extension of the va n Vleck-Gutzwiller propagator, for the study of bound-free transition amplitudes of Rydberg H atoms, initially prepared in quasi-one-dimensi onal Stark states (n = 100), which are ionized by intense half-cycle p ulses. Oscillations in the ionization spectra are described by interfe rence between pairs of classical path amplitudes. The rate of the osci llations depends linearly on the initial principle quantum number n, a nd the amplitude of the oscillations depends sensitively upon the puls e length and whether the initial state is orientated with or against t he direction of electromagnetic polarization.
